DNA, or deoxyribonucleic acid, is the molecule that contains the genetic instructions for all living organisms Each person’s DNA is unique, with the exception of identical twins who share the exact same genetic code Siblings, on the other hand, share about 50% of their DNA with each other on average This shared genetic material plays a significant role in shaping the physical and behavioral traits that siblings have in common.
One of the most obvious ways that DNA influences siblings is through their physical appearance While siblings may look very similar or very different from each other, their shared genetic material is responsible for many of the physical traits they have in common This can include things like eye color, hair color, height, and even certain facial features For example, siblings who both have curly hair or freckles may have inherited these traits from their parents and share them due to their shared genetic material.
In addition to physical traits, DNA also plays a role in shaping siblings’ personalities and behaviors While personality is influenced by a combination of genetic and environmental factors, siblings who share genetic material are more likely to have similar personality traits This can manifest in things like shared interests, values, and even tendencies towards certain behaviors dna and siblings. For example, siblings who both have a talent for music or a love of the outdoors may have inherited these traits from their parents and share them due to their shared genetic material.
Despite the influence of DNA, siblings can still be very different from each other in many ways This is because while they share genetic material, they are also influenced by a wide range of environmental factors that can shape their development and personality Things like birth order, family dynamics, and life experiences can all play a role in shaping the unique individuals that siblings become.
Interestingly, research has shown that siblings who grow up in the same household can have very different experiences and outcomes This is because even though they share genetic material, each sibling has a unique combination of genes that can interact with their environment in different ways For example, one sibling may have a genetic predisposition for a certain disease, but if they have a healthy lifestyle and access to good healthcare, they may never develop the disease On the other hand, another sibling with the same genetic predisposition may develop the disease due to other factors in their environment.
